by and large
Meaning
- (focus, idiomatic, not-comparable) Mostly; generally; all things considered.
- (idiomatic, not-comparable, obsolete) In one way or another.
- (not-comparable) Sailing alternately into the wind and in the same direction as the wind.

Etymology
From sailing: a ship may (or may not) sail well both close by the wind, and large, downwind, with sheets extended.
